To Whom It May Concern:

This is a request under the Freedom of Information Act. I hereby request the following records:

Any and all documents awarding compensation and/or discussing compensation and/or assessing rates of compensation to local national owners of land taken through an eminent domain process (or similar process) by American or coalition military or by Iraqi military, police, or other security service for the purpose of use as a military outpost, base, security station, or other fortification, or for the purpose of constructing a military outpost, base, security station, or other fortification in Iraq from March 2003 to the present.

The requested documents will be made available to the general public, and this request is not being made for commercial purposes.

In the event that fees cannot be waived, I would be grateful if you would inform me of the total charges in advance of fulfilling my request. I would prefer the request filled electronically, by e-mail attachment if available or CD-ROM if not.

Thank you in advance for your anticipated cooperation in this matter. I look forward to receiving your response to this request within 20 business days, as the statute requires.

Thank you for your request. USCENTCOM received your FOIA request, dated 30 September 2015. We are processing your request; however, additional information is required to perfect your FOIA request. The Department of Defense Freedom of Information Act Program, 5400.7-R, require requesters to state a fee amount they are willing to pay in the event processing fees are incurred. Though in a majority of cases fees are not assessed to the requester, it is necessary to request that you please reply to this e-mail with said willingness and amount. We’ve placed you in the "Media" category for fee purposes. This means you will be obligated to pay duplication cost ($.15 per page) after the first 100 pages.
